Transaction 52695bc889abbfd0e60891469e5a653558cf2c9bc15b470fbbf4f40303958074

1 Input
2 Outputs
  • 52695bc889abbfd0e60891469e5a653558cf2c9bc15b470fbbf4f40303958074:0
  • value  2460773
    address  31tA9nTrpAkagqgVZoJ3pzjjD6gzYEYWsN
  • 52695bc889abbfd0e60891469e5a653558cf2c9bc15b470fbbf4f40303958074:1
  • value  2647527
    address  123xRMt7Th5WhNXb2Aktp3vXjNWySYTBoT